DiBiase and sons ordered to repay around $5 million in misspent welfare funds

WWE Hall of Famer Ted DiBiase and his two sons have been ordered to return around $5 million in illegally spent welfare funds by Mississippi State Auditor Shad White.

In a report which appeared on the Mississippi Free Press, the Million Dollar Man was ordered to return the $722,299 that his Christian ministry, Heart of David Ministries, received over the years.

His son and former WWE Superstar Ted DiBiase Jr owes a whopping $3.9 million in misspent funds and Brett DiBiase owes a further $225,950.

Last year, Brett DiBiase accepted a plea agreement and pleaded guilty to making false statements in front of a Hinds County judge. In exchange for becoming a witness in the case, prosecutors withdrew a conspiracy charge against him.

Several other individuals, including NFL star Brett Favre, owe hundreds of thousands of dollars in welfare funds that should have gone to needy families instead.
